Square Enix may have finally officially unveiled Marvel’s Avengers at E3 this year, but it’s only off late that we’ve started receiving tangible new information about the upcoming title. Just recently, in fact, the developers released a short new video that included the profile for Captain America, speaking about the First Avenger’s strengths and weaknesses. To go along with that, the game’s official Twitter account also shared some interesting new information on how he functions in combat.

With a mixture of abilities, signature moves, melee attacks, ranged attacks, and aerial attacks, Captain America’s combat style is, as per Lead Combat Designer Vince Napoli, “all about balance”. Napoli says that Cap has “the widest variety of options at his disposal” during combat, and his arsenal offers something for every situation, including parries, crowd control, counter-attacks, ranged attacks, and more.

Meanwhile, though Cap has a unique play-style and his own moves and combos and skills to unlock and upgrade, players can also use gear, upgrades, and perks to customize him to suit their own playstyle, and change his fighting style to match their needs.

It should be interesting to see how Cap functions as far as the co-op multiplayer side of the game is concerned, because if he really is as adept at tackling all sorts of situations as it seems, he might quickly become a fan-favourite.

Marvel’s Avengers is out on May 15, 2020 for the PS4, Xbox One, PC, and Stadia. Check out its recent 20 minute-long gameplay demo through here.
